What Year Homes Are Most Likely to Have Asbestos?

If you own an older home, you might be wondering about the presence of asbestos. Research and historical building practices tell us that homes constructed roughly between the 1930s and the early 1980s are the most likely to contain asbestos-containing materials (ACMs). This was a peak period for its use in residential construction. It’s not that all homes from these years definitely have asbestos, but the probability is significantly higher.

Common Places to Find Asbestos in Your Home

You might be surprised where asbestos hid. It wasn’t just in the obvious places like attic insulation. Many everyday building products contained it. This widespread use means it’s found in various parts of a house. Understanding these common locations can help you identify potential risks.

  • Insulation: Especially around pipes, boilers, and in attics.
  • Flooring: Vinyl tiles and the adhesive used to glue them down.
  • Ceiling tiles: Acoustic tiles often contained asbestos.
  • Roofing and Siding: Shingles and exterior panels.
  • Textured paints: Popcorn ceilings and decorative wall coatings.
  • Drywall and Joint Compound: Used for finishing walls and ceilings.
  • Furnace Ducts: Insulation wrapped around ductwork.

The Era of Asbestos Use: A Timeline

While asbestos use dates back much further, its prevalence in homes surged after World War II. From the late 1940s through the 1970s, it was a staple. Regulations began to tighten in the 1970s, leading to a decline in its use. By the late 1980s, most applications were banned or heavily restricted in many countries. This timeline is a good indicator for homeowners.

When Does Asbestos Become a Danger?

Asbestos itself isn’t dangerous if it’s left undisturbed and in good condition. The risk arises when these materials are damaged, disturbed, or during renovations. When ACMs break apart, microscopic fibers are released into the air. These fibers are incredibly light and can stay airborne for a long time. Inhaling these fibers is what causes serious health problems.

Mesothelioma Risk from Asbestos Exposure

The most well-known health risk associated with asbestos exposure is mesothelioma. This is a rare and aggressive cancer. Other serious respiratory diseases, like asbestosis and lung cancer, are also linked to inhaling asbestos fibers. The mesothelioma risk asbestos poses is a primary reason for careful handling and removal. It’s a risk you absolutely do not want to take during home restoration projects.

Exposure doesn’t always mean immediate illness. The effects can take many years, even decades, to appear. This latency period makes it difficult to link past exposures to current health issues. It underscores the importance of preventing exposure in the first place. Even low-level exposure during home improvement can contribute to long-term risks. Identifying Potential Asbestos in Your Home

Visually identifying asbestos can be tricky. Many ACMs look like ordinary building materials. The only sure way to know if a material contains asbestos is through professional testing. If your home was built during the high-use period, and you plan any kind of renovation or repair work, testing for asbestos is a smart first step. Don’t guess; get it tested.

DIY vs. Professional Asbestos Testing

While DIY asbestos test kits are available, they are generally not recommended. They can be inaccurate, and improper handling during sampling can actually release fibers. It is always best to call a professional for asbestos testing. Certified inspectors have the training and equipment to collect samples safely and accurately. They can also provide guidance on next steps.

What to Do If You Suspect Asbestos

If you suspect you have asbestos in your home, the most important thing is not to disturb the material. Don’t drill, saw, sand, or scrape it. If it’s in good condition and won’t be disturbed by your planned work, you might be able to leave it in place. However, if it’s damaged or you’re planning renovations, you’ll need professional help.

Asbestos Abatement: A Job for Experts

Asbestos removal, or abatement, is a highly specialized process. It requires strict containment measures to prevent fiber release. Certified professionals follow established protocols. They use negative air pressure systems and specialized filters. Never attempt to remove asbestos yourself. It’s a dangerous task with serious health consequences.

Disposal of Asbestos-Containing Materials

Proper disposal of asbestos waste is also regulated. It cannot simply be thrown away with regular trash. Specialized landfills are designated for asbestos waste. What are the main health risks of asbestos exposure?

The primary health risks associated with inhaling asbestos fibers include lung cancer, mesothelioma (a rare cancer of the lining of the lungs, abdomen, or heart), and asbestosis (a chronic lung disease that causes scarring of the lungs). These conditions often take many years to develop after exposure.

Can I just seal or paint over asbestos material?

Painting or sealing may temporarily cover asbestos-containing materials, but it does not eliminate the hazard. If the material underneath deteriorates or is disturbed, fibers can still be released. It is not a long-term solution and can create a false sense of security. Professional assessment is always recommended.

What if my home was built in the 1990s?

Homes built in the 1990s are much less likely to contain asbestos, as its use was significantly restricted by then. However, some older building materials might have still been used up in the early part of the decade. If you have specific concerns about a particular material, testing is still the most reliable way to know for sure.

Is it safe to live in a home with asbestos?

It can be safe to live in a home with asbestos if the material is in good condition and remains undisturbed. The danger arises when asbestos-containing materials are damaged or disturbed, releasing fibers into the air. Regular inspections and careful maintenance are key to managing the risk.
